What is DTF Printing? The Technical Breakdown

DTF printing is an advanced digital printing technique that employs producing designs on unique PET film using aqueous inks and adhesive powder. Unlike standard printing processes, DTF transfers can be applied to multiple fabric types from natural to synthetic without pretreatment. This adaptability makes DTF printer technology highly sought-after among companies wanting effective, premium printing solutions.

The method produces prints that are both aesthetically impressive but also incredibly durable. DTF transfers resist deterioration and color loss even after multiple washes, making them ideal for commercial applications where durability is essential. With the capacity to reproduce complex patterns, gradients, and photorealistic images, DTF printing provides infinite creative options for your operation.

The DTF Transfer Process: Detailed Instructions

Producing high-end DTF transfers requires understanding each stage of the process. Here's a detailed breakdown:

1. Design Creation and Preparation

Begin with designing your graphic using professional software like Photoshop, CorelDRAW, or simpler options like online design platforms. Output your design as a high-resolution PNG file with a transparent background. The benefit of DTF printing is that you can create detailed multicolor graphics without concerning yourself with color restrictions.

2. Printing Your DTF Transfer

Load your design into the DTF printer application. The printer will initially apply the CMYK inks (CMYK) directly onto the PET film, followed by a white ink layer that acts as a base. This white layer is crucial for achieving vibrant colors on dark fabrics. Modern DTF printer models can reach speeds of up to 40 linear meters per minute, making them perfect for high-volume production.

3. Powder Application

While the ink is still wet, consistently distribute hot-melt adhesive powder over the entire printed design. This powder is what attaches the DTF transfer to the fabric during application. Use a sweeping action to achieve complete coverage, then eliminate any excess powder. Many operations are now investing in automated powder shakers for reliable results.

4. Curing the Transfer

The adhesive powder needs to be thermally set before application. This can be done using a curing oven (recommended for optimal results) or by hovering under a heat press. Curing typically takes 60-90 seconds in an oven at the appropriate temperature. Correct curing ensures your DTF transfers can be stored for later use or used immediately.

5. Applying to Garment

First press your garment for a few seconds to remove moisture and wrinkles. Align your DTF transfer on the fabric and press at recommended heat setting for optimal duration with moderate force. The heat activates the adhesive, establishing a lasting connection between the design and fabric.

6. Removal and Finishing

Following application, strip the film while it's still heated in one continuous action. This immediate peeling technique ensures sharp details and prevents unwanted lines in your design. Lastly, complete a second press for another short duration to improve durability and reduce shine.

Why DTF Printing is Dominating the Market in 2025

The DTF printing market has witnessed explosive growth, valued at substantial market value in 2024 and forecast to reach $3.92 billion by 2030. This impressive development is driven by several important elements:

Unmatched Versatility

Unlike other printing methods, DTF transfers work on almost every fabric material without preprocessing. From pure cotton to artificial fabrics, leather to nylon, DTF printing provides reliable, premium results across all surfaces.

Any Volume Production

If you require one custom shirt or thousands, DTF printer technology abolishes setup costs and minimum quantities. This flexibility makes it ideal for on-demand printing, personalized orders, and testing new designs without monetary commitment.

Premium Results

Modern DTF printing creates remarkably precise, vibrant prints that equal or beat conventional techniques. The technology excels at generating detailed photographs, smooth color transitions, and minute elements that would be problematic with alternative techniques.

Economic Efficiency

With reduced initial investment than screen printing and speedier output than DTG printing, DTF transfers provide an excellent profit potential. The capability to gang multiple designs on a single sheet also decreases costs and supply usage.

Necessary Hardware for Successful Operations

To start your DTF printing venture, you'll need the following machinery:

  • DTF Printer: Pick between purpose-built models by manufacturers like top manufacturers, or adapt existing printers for DTF printing
  • Specialty Inks: Formulated textile inks developed for best adhesion and color intensity
  • PET Film: Offered as rolls or sheets, with varied peel options
  • Bonding Powder: White powder for most uses, black for dark designs on dark fabrics
  • Heat Press: Professional press with reliable temperature and pressure
  • Powder Dryer: For proper powder curing (essential)
  • Print Software: For color management and output enhancement
